From e2ad4ab9b2870341606c14a039dbf945097ae022 Mon Sep 17 00:00:00 2001 From: Adi Oanca Date: Thu, 10 Nov 2005 21:52:59 +0000 Subject: [PATCH] Not in mood for too much coding, I had a look through the code tonight. And guess what? Like Stefano the other day, I discovered, not a bug, but how to invalidate only the area that requires it when changing window order (selecting or moving to back a window). Stuppid me, that stuff didn't worked because I forgot how windows were arranged in the list returned by Workspace::GetWMState().
